Old     (ccwhite)      Join Date: Jul 2004       02-07-2005, 10:40 AM Reply   
I wouldnt call a X-2/X-10/Nautique an 'Into' boat. I'd call those %100 absolute full on wakeboard boats.

I've been boat shoping for the last year and here is a quick list in $$ order from cheapest acceptable wakeboard boat to most expensive (priced with the options I wanted). There are other boats out there, these are just the ones that ended up on my final cut list.

Moomba LSV (or Mobious LSV) $38K
Sanger v215/Supra 21V $42K
Malibu VLX $50K
SANTE/X-anything $59K
- NOTE - The Mastercraft and Natiques were out of my price range so I didnt price each model out like I did the other boats.

for my money, I liked the Sanger v215 and the Supra 21v.

If thats what it takes to help yourself get one.. Yep. Its impossible to improve and have fun w/o owning a wakeboard boat

Something to remember, is that new boats can often be financed over 12 years. That makes a 50K boat payment around $500/month.

Im trying to buy my first boat now, and I want a v215. The boat payment is $450, Storage $100, insurance $100, Maint $100 (I plan on having to spend $1200 yearly so I add it into my budgeted monthly costs) and Gas (at 1 tank a week, and no $$ help from riders) was about $400/month. So to own and operate a boat I estimated about $1k/month. I know this is high, but better plan for worse case, instead of owning a boat and not being able to use it.
